Ansys is a software suite of Ansys Inc.
Ansys Discovery provides instantaneous 3D simulation, tightly coupled with direct geometry modeling, to enable interactive design exploration and rapid product innovation. It is an interactive experience in which you can manipulate geometry, material types or physics inputs, then instantaneously see changes in performance.
Answer critical design questions earlier, without waiting days or weeks for traditional simulation results.
Ansys Discovery seamlessly aligns with proven Ansys solver technology to provide additional detail and calculate a high-fidelity result for increased confidence. When you need it, use the Fluent or the Mechanical solver within the Discovery environment without changing your model or your workflow.
